    I was going to suggest something similar...Bruges/Brugge is lovely & only about an hour away from Brussels on the train. Easy as a day trip or to actually stay there.

    We went over bank holiday weekend, although flew rather than Eurostar. Arrived late Friday night, spent Saturday & Sunday morning in Brussels then took the train to Bruges, flew home late Monday night.

    I think Belgium generally is quite underrated - we thought both Brussels & Bruges were really nice places, especially if you like good food &/or beer, and just enough to see for a weekend break.
